版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
專升本《面向?qū)ο蟪绦蛟O(shè)計(jì)》專升本《面向?qū)ο蟪绦蛟O(shè)計(jì)》專升本《面向?qū)ο蟪绦蛟O(shè)計(jì)》資料僅供參考文件編號(hào):2022年4月專升本《面向?qū)ο蟪绦蛟O(shè)計(jì)》版本號(hào):A修改號(hào):1頁次:1.0審核:批準(zhǔn):發(fā)布日期:一、單選(共20題,每題2分,共40分)1.對(duì)于定義成員b->a的類型為()。2.一個(gè)左值必然不是()。A.一個(gè)對(duì)象B.一個(gè)函數(shù)調(diào)用C.一個(gè)變量D.一個(gè)常量3.如果不是釋放數(shù)組指針指向的內(nèi)存,delete后面使用的指針的類型為()。****4.對(duì)于定義會(huì)()。A.先調(diào)用缺省析構(gòu)函數(shù)~E()一次,再釋放p指向的對(duì)象內(nèi)存B.先調(diào)用缺省析構(gòu)函數(shù)~E()十次,再釋放p指向的對(duì)象內(nèi)存C.先調(diào)用缺省析構(gòu)函數(shù)~F()十次,再釋放p指向的對(duì)象內(nèi)存D.先調(diào)用缺省析構(gòu)函數(shù)~F()一次,再釋放p指向的對(duì)象內(nèi)存5.內(nèi)聯(lián)函數(shù)通常()。A.函數(shù)體較小,且不應(yīng)有分支類型的語句B.函數(shù)體較小,且應(yīng)該有分支類型的語句C.函數(shù)體較大,且應(yīng)該有分支類型的語句D.函數(shù)體較大,且不應(yīng)有分支類型的語句++的名字空間不能包含()A.函數(shù)定義B.類型定義C.變量定義D.數(shù)值常量++指針變量int*const&p表示()。A.右邊的引用引用左邊的指針,且左邊的指針不能被修改B.左邊的指針指向右邊的引用,且左邊的指針不能被修改C.右邊的引用引用左邊的指針,且右邊的引用不能被修改D.左邊的指針指向右邊的引用,且右邊的引用不能被修改8.對(duì)于如下操作合法的為()。9.引用變量()。A.邏輯上要分配內(nèi)存,必須引用分配內(nèi)存的變量B.邏輯上不分配內(nèi)存,必須引用分配內(nèi)存的變量C.邏輯上要分配內(nèi)存,可以引用不分配內(nèi)存的變量D.邏輯上不分配內(nèi)存,可以引用不分配內(nèi)存的變量++的類F定義的類F的函數(shù)成員()。A.不能定義為friend和static的B.可以定義為friend的,不能定義為static的C.不能定義為friend的,可以定義為static的D.可以定義為friend和static的11.關(guān)于C++的struct,定義的成員()。A.缺省都是公有成員,不能定義私有成員B.缺省都是私有成員,但可以定義公有成員C.缺省都是公有成員,但可以定義私有成員D.缺省都是私有成員,不能定義公有成員++的數(shù)組元素不可以()。A.是整數(shù)B.是函數(shù)C.是數(shù)組D.是指針13.對(duì)于類F定義Ff[10][20],可以認(rèn)為f[10]()。A.是一個(gè)指針,指向數(shù)組的第20個(gè)元素B.是一個(gè)10元素?cái)?shù)組,每個(gè)元素存放1個(gè)F類對(duì)象;C.是一個(gè)10元素?cái)?shù)組,每個(gè)元素存放20個(gè)F類對(duì)象;D.是一個(gè)指針,指向數(shù)組的第10個(gè)元素;14.對(duì)枚舉類型定義的元素()。A.可以指定整型值,且整型值可以重復(fù)指定給不同枚舉元素B.不能指定整型值,且整型值不得重復(fù)指定給不同枚舉元素C.可以指定整型值,且整型值不得重復(fù)指定給不同枚舉元素D.不能指定整型值,且整型值可以重復(fù)指定給不同枚舉元素++的析構(gòu)函數(shù)()。A.可以重載,不能定義返回類型B.可以重載,可以定義返回類型C.不能重載,可以定義返回類型D.不能重載,不能定義返回類型16.關(guān)于.保留字struct和class,正確的敘述為()。A.只有class可以定義類,因此不能相互替代B.都可以定義類,且不能相互替代C.都可以定義類,且可以相互替代D.都不對(duì)17.關(guān)于表達(dá)式++(x++),如下哪個(gè)敘述正確()。A.錯(cuò)誤B.都不對(duì)C.正確,且最終增加1D.正確,且最終增加218.關(guān)于運(yùn)算符函數(shù)%的重載,正確的敘述為()。A.可以重載為單目運(yùn)算,但改變運(yùn)算符的結(jié)合性B.可以重載為雙目運(yùn)算,但不改變運(yùn)算符的結(jié)合性C.可以重載為雙目運(yùn)算,但改變運(yùn)算符的結(jié)合性D.可以重載為單目運(yùn)算,但不改變運(yùn)算符的結(jié)合性19.函數(shù)的所有缺省值參數(shù)應(yīng)()。A.出現(xiàn)在參數(shù)表的左部,其中可以參雜非缺省值參數(shù)B.出現(xiàn)在參數(shù)表的左部,其中不能參雜非缺省值參數(shù)C.出現(xiàn)在參數(shù)表的右部,其中可以參雜非缺省值參數(shù)D.出現(xiàn)在參數(shù)表的右部,其中不能參雜非缺省值參數(shù)20.對(duì)于定義函數(shù)f的隱含參數(shù)this的類型為()。*volatile*const*const*const二、多選(共5題,每題2分,共10分)1.關(guān)于定義int*p,()。A.++p是左值B.*p是左值是左值++是左值++的運(yùn)算符“--”可以重載為如下哪些類型的函數(shù)()。A.雙目函數(shù)B.三目函數(shù)C.四目函數(shù)D.單目函數(shù)3.若類不自定義函數(shù)成員,C++編譯器會(huì)提供缺省的()。A.賦值運(yùn)算符函數(shù)B.無參構(gòu)造函數(shù)C.析構(gòu)函數(shù)D.拷貝構(gòu)造函數(shù)++具有如下特點(diǎn)()。A.支持運(yùn)算符重載B.兼容C語言C.可自動(dòng)回收內(nèi)存D.支持多繼承5.運(yùn)算符::可以做()。A.單目運(yùn)算符B.都不對(duì)C.三目運(yùn)算符D.雙目運(yùn)算符一、單選(共20題,每題2分,共40分)1.標(biāo)準(zhǔn)答案:D2.標(biāo)準(zhǔn)答案:D3.標(biāo)準(zhǔn)答案:D4.標(biāo)準(zhǔn)答案:B5.標(biāo)準(zhǔn)答案:A6.標(biāo)準(zhǔn)答案:D7.標(biāo)準(zhǔn)答案:C8.標(biāo)準(zhǔn)答案:D9.標(biāo)準(zhǔn)答案:B10.標(biāo)準(zhǔn)答案:C11.標(biāo)準(zhǔn)答案:C12.標(biāo)準(zhǔn)答案:B13.標(biāo)準(zhǔn)答案:C14.標(biāo)準(zhǔn)答案:A15.標(biāo)準(zhǔn)答案:D16.標(biāo)準(zhǔn)答案:C17.標(biāo)準(zhǔn)答案:A18.標(biāo)準(zhǔn)答案:B19.標(biāo)準(zhǔn)答案:D20.標(biāo)準(zhǔn)答案:B二、多選(共5題,每題2分,共10分)1.標(biāo)準(zhǔn)答案:A,B,C2.標(biāo)準(zhǔn)答案:A,D3.標(biāo)準(zhǔn)答案:A,B,C,D4.標(biāo)準(zhǔn)答案:A,B,D5.標(biāo)準(zhǔn)答案:A,D一、單項(xiàng)選擇題(本大題共20小題,每小題分,共40分)1.函數(shù)成員的晚期綁定是由()執(zhí)行的。A.編輯程序 B.編譯程序 C.操作系統(tǒng) D.程序自身 2.面向?qū)ο蟮姆庋b是將()包裝在一起。A.類型、屬性、方法 B.電子元件器件 C.數(shù)值類型常量 D.文字類型常量 或C++的標(biāo)準(zhǔn)函數(shù)scanf的返回值為()。A.長(zhǎng)整型且等于輸入的變量個(gè)數(shù) B.長(zhǎng)整型且等于輸入的字符個(gè)數(shù) C.整型且等于輸入的變量個(gè)數(shù) D.整型且等于輸入的字符個(gè)數(shù) 4.枚舉類型定義的枚舉元素的類型可看作是()。類型 類型 類型 類型 5.枚舉類型定義的元素必須是()。A.標(biāo)識(shí)符且個(gè)數(shù)無限 B.變量名且個(gè)數(shù)無限 C.標(biāo)識(shí)符且個(gè)數(shù)有限 D.變量名且個(gè)數(shù)有限 6.使用cin>>x>>y輸入,正確的說法是()。是輸入函數(shù),一次接受兩個(gè)實(shí)參x和y是輸入函數(shù),每次接受一個(gè)實(shí)參,因此,cin函數(shù)被調(diào)用兩次C.>>是輸入函數(shù),一次接受兩個(gè)實(shí)參:cin和要輸入的變量x(或者y)D.>>是輸入函數(shù),一次接受三個(gè)實(shí)參:cin、x、y或C++的標(biāo)準(zhǔn)函數(shù)printf的返回值為()。A.長(zhǎng)整型且等于打印的值的個(gè)數(shù) B.長(zhǎng)整型且等于打印的字符個(gè)數(shù) C.整型且等于打印的值的個(gè)數(shù) D.整型且等于打印的字符個(gè)數(shù) ++的數(shù)組變量不可以用()。A.類型名初始化 B.變量名初始化 C.函數(shù)名初始化 D.常量名初始化 9.表達(dá)式sizeof(char)+sizeof(printf("3"))/sizeof(int)的值為()。 10.對(duì)于定義“double*x;”,則sizeofx/sizeof(void*)的值為()。 11.指向類ABC的一個(gè)對(duì)象的指針是()。A.簡(jiǎn)單類型 B.數(shù)組類型 類型 類型 12.對(duì)于void*p定義的指針變量p,將賦值到p所指向的整型存儲(chǔ)單元的正確形式為()。A.*p= B.*p=(int) C.*(int*)p= D.(int)*p= 13.使用類F定義變量“Ff[10][20];”,可以認(rèn)為f[8]()。A.是一個(gè)10元素?cái)?shù)組,每個(gè)元素存放1個(gè)F類對(duì)象;B.是一個(gè)20元素?cái)?shù)組,每個(gè)元素存放1個(gè)F類對(duì)象;C.是一個(gè)對(duì)象指針,指向數(shù)組f的第8個(gè)元素;D.是一個(gè)對(duì)象指針,指向數(shù)組f的第10個(gè)元素14.對(duì)于“intx=3;intf(int&y){++y;return::x+y;}”,調(diào)用f(x)的返回值為()。 15.對(duì)于定義“intu=3;int&w=++u;int&v=++w;”,正確的敘述為()。引用u,v引用w 引用u,v引用u 未引用u,v引用w 未引用u,v未引用w ++的數(shù)組元素不可以是()。類型 類型 C.引用類型 類型 17.對(duì)于定義“intf(){registerintx=1;int*p=&x;return*p;}”,正確的理解為()。是寄存器變量,所以不能有取地址運(yùn)算即&x是register變量,不會(huì)轉(zhuǎn)化為auto變量C.因?qū)取地址&x,故x被自動(dòng)編譯為auto類型的變量D.返回的是對(duì)寄存器變量x的引用++指針參數(shù)int*const&p表示()。A.左邊的指針指向右邊的引用,且右邊的引用不能被修改B.左邊的指針指向右邊的引用,且左邊的指針不能被修改C.右邊的引用引用左邊的指針,且右邊的引用不能被修改D.右邊的引用引用左邊的指針,且左邊的指針不能被修改19.關(guān)于引用變量的描述,下面哪個(gè)正確()。A.邏輯上不分配內(nèi)存,必須引用其它分配內(nèi)存的變量B.邏輯上要分配內(nèi)存,必須引用其它分配內(nèi)存的變量C.邏輯上不分配內(nèi)存,可以引用不分配內(nèi)存的變量D.邏輯上要分配內(nèi)存,可以引用不分配內(nèi)存的變量20.對(duì)于定義“intx=3;int&y=x;constint&z=y;”,正確的說法是()。引用y,由于y是左值,所以z也是左值 引用x,由于x是左值,所以z也是左值 只讀引用y,所以z是右值 只讀引用x,所以z是右值 二、多項(xiàng)選擇題(本大題共5小題,每小題分,共10分)1.對(duì)于全局對(duì)象數(shù)組變量,關(guān)于開工與收工正確的理解包括()。A.它在main執(zhí)行前就多次調(diào)用構(gòu)造函數(shù)初始化每個(gè)元素B.它在main結(jié)束后才多次調(diào)用析構(gòu)造函數(shù)銷毀每個(gè)元素C.它在main執(zhí)行時(shí)才多次調(diào)用構(gòu)造函數(shù)初始化每個(gè)元素D.它在main結(jié)束前就多次調(diào)用析構(gòu)造函數(shù)銷毀每個(gè)元素2.關(guān)于cin>>x>>y正確的理解包括()。是istream類的一個(gè)全局對(duì)象或變量類重載雙目運(yùn)算符>>用于輸入變量x>>返回cin的引用以便“cin>>x”的返回值可用以繼續(xù)輸入yD.全局對(duì)象cin在main返回前不會(huì)被析構(gòu),所以cin總是可用3.定義一個(gè)全局變量的要素包括()。A.說明其類型 B.說明其是否為virtual的 C.說明其名稱 D.說明其初始值 4.若派生類非靜態(tài)函數(shù)成員不是其基類的友元,則該函數(shù)()。A.能夠訪問基類的私有成員 B.能夠訪問基類的保護(hù)成員 C.能夠訪問基類的公有成員 D.能夠訪問基類的名字空間成員 5.對(duì)于定義“intf(A
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 二零二五版跨境電商平臺(tái)傭金比例調(diào)整合同3篇
- 二零二五版?zhèn)€人教育貸款擔(dān)保合同模板3篇
- 二零二五年建筑裝修幫工雇傭合同2篇
- 二零二五版寄賣合同范本:藝術(shù)品寄售代理中介服務(wù)協(xié)議2篇
- 二零二五版辦公設(shè)備智能化升級(jí)改造合同5篇
- 二零二五版橋梁工程勞務(wù)分包合同模板6篇
- 二零二五版職工住房借款與社區(qū)文化活動(dòng)支持合同3篇
- 二零二五年度黃牛養(yǎng)殖與屠宰行業(yè)購(gòu)銷法律法規(guī)遵守合同3篇
- 二零二五年鋁藝門安裝與外觀設(shè)計(jì)承包合同3篇
- 二零二五年度電商代發(fā)貨及品牌授權(quán)合同2篇
- 監(jiān)理報(bào)告范本
- 店鋪交割合同范例
- 大型活動(dòng)LED屏幕安全應(yīng)急預(yù)案
- 2024年內(nèi)蒙古包頭市中考道德與法治試卷
- 湖南省長(zhǎng)沙市2024-2025學(xué)年高二上學(xué)期期中考試地理試卷(含答案)
- 自來水質(zhì)量提升技術(shù)方案
- 金色簡(jiǎn)約蛇年年終總結(jié)匯報(bào)模板
- 農(nóng)用地土壤環(huán)境質(zhì)量類別劃分技術(shù)指南(試行)(環(huán)辦土壤2017第97號(hào))
- 反向開票政策解讀課件
- 工程周工作計(jì)劃
- 房地產(chǎn)銷售任務(wù)及激勵(lì)制度
評(píng)論
0/150
提交評(píng)論